Smithers, B.C. spending almost $400,000 on private security, safety upgrades at homeless camp
Following ongoing disorder and repeated fires, council recently approved spending up to $234,000 per year for private security to monitor the camp.
Caroline Marko doesn’t believe the small northwestern B.C. community has a housing or homeless problem, and said the fundamental issue is drugs.
